<p class="MsoNormal"><span>On the <a href="http://outbackpower.com/products/charge-controllers/flexmax-100">FM100 landing page</a>. The warning is pasted below.</span></p>
<p class="MsoNormal"><span> </span></p>
<p class="MsoNormal" style="margin-left: .5in;"><em><span>Due to the different voltage ratings, OutBack Power does not recommend mixing the FM100-300VDC with the FM60 or FM80-150VDC controllers on the same battery bank.</span></em></p>
<p class="MsoNormal"><span> </span></p>
<p class="MsoNormal"><span>Interestingly the warning is not seen on the <a href="http://outbackpower.com/products/charge-controllers/flexmax-100-afci">FM100 AFCI landing page</a>.</span></p>
<p class="MsoNormal"><span> </span></p>
<p class="MsoNormal"><span>I thought I saw this also in one of the Owner's manuals but I looked today and can't find it there. Interesting...</span></p>
<p class="MsoNormal"><span> </span></p>
<p class="MsoNormal"><span>I have a client that wants to add a fourth PV array to a system with three FM80s. This will require a fourth charge controller. Being able to run smaller wire in the existing conduits is an attractive proposition, making the FM100 a desirable approach. I now have to figure out if I can add the FM100-AFCI (which is apparently the only version available) to a system with three FM80s, and if I do, what do I do with the existing GFDI breaker and how do I arrange the DC bond? There is a lot to consider here.</span></p>
<p class="MsoNormal"><span> </span></p>
<p class="MsoNormal"><span>BTW, I was told by a tech support person for an on-line sales firm that the original FM100 did not have the AFCI but those units have been discontinued. Now all FM100s have the AFCI capability. I am weighing if I want AFCI if it is not required. My territory includes central California wild lands so I suppose I should take advantage of any fire safety means at my disposal...</span></p>

<p class="MsoNormal"><span style="font-size: 12.0pt;">Friends:</span></p>
<p class="MsoNormal"><span style="font-size: 12.0pt;"> </span></p>
<p class="MsoNormal"><span style="font-size: 12.0pt;">I have occasion to try the FM100 charge controller. I am wondering of anyone had found any quirks with implementing this device. I have a few specific questions:</span></p>
<p class="MsoNormal"><span style="font-size: 12.0pt;"> </span></p>
<p class="MsoListParagraph" style="text-indent: -.25in; mso-list: l0 level1 lfo2;"><span style="mso-list: Ignore;">1.<span style="font: 7.0pt;"> </span></span><span style="font-size: 12.0pt;">I want to avoid AFCI unless mandated. Will this be defeated if I don't run the leads through the sense coil? (There is an AFCI and non-AFCI version but I can't seem to find the non-AFCI version anywhere.)</span></p>
<p class="MsoListParagraph" style="text-indent: -.25in; mso-list: l0 level1 lfo2;"><span style="mso-list: Ignore;">2.<span style="font: 7.0pt;"> </span></span><span style="font-size: 12.0pt;">I noticed the manual indicates you are not supposed to mix the FM100 with the FM80 or 60 in the same battery system. This negates it for one project I had in mind. I am curious as to why this is. Anyone know?</span></p>
<p class="MsoListParagraph" style="text-indent: -.25in; mso-list: l0 level1 lfo2;"><span style="mso-list: Ignore;">3.<span style="font: 7.0pt;"> </span></span><span style="font-size: 12.0pt;">Will the FM100 work with a standard hub?</span></p>
<p class="MsoListParagraph" style="text-indent: -.25in; mso-list: l0 level1 lfo2;"><span style="mso-list: Ignore;">4.<span style="font: 7.0pt;"> </span></span><span style="font-size: 12.0pt;">I suppose this unit requires a 125 amp breaker. If the PV array cannot support that full 100 amps I might down-size the OCPD accordingly. Anyone contemplate this question?</span></p>
